Ajman Tourism to showcase Emirate’s iconic
attractions and experiences at ITB Berlin 2025
03/03/2025
UAE, 2 March 2025: Ajman Department of Tourism Development (ADTD) is set to showcase the Emirate’s
best-in-class tourist, cultural and hospitality offerings at ITB Berlin 2025, one of the world’s largest trade
shows convening leading players in the international tourism sector, which will take place from 4 to 6 March
in Berlin, Germany. This participation underscores ADTD’s commitment to enhancing Ajman’s stature as a
leading global tourist destination by attracting industry leaders, tour operators, and travel enthusiasts from all
around the globe.
As part of its participation at the event, ADTD will highlight Ajman’s forward-looking vision for sustainable
development, positioning the Emirate as a prime destination for international tourist brands seeking
promising markets and potential visitors. Moreover, leading travel agencies and hospitality brands from
Ajman will also take part in the event, spotlighting the Emirate’s exemplary tourism and hospitality landscape.
These include ‘Ajman Saray – A Luxury Collection Resort’, ‘Fairmont Ajman’, ‘Ajman Hotel managed by
Blazon Hotels’, ‘Bahi Hotel’, ‘Wyndham Garden Ajman Corniche’, ‘Perfect Journeys’, as well as ‘Rida
International Tourism & Travel’.

The participation coincides with the rapid expansion of the Ajman tourism sector, which witnessed an 8 per
cent increase in visitor inflow and a 5 per cent rise in tourist revenue last year as compared to 2023. With
international travellers comprising over 62 per cent of total visitors, led by German tourists, ITB Berlin 2025
presents an ideal platform to amplify this momentum, expand market reach, and drive investments into the
Emirate’s flourishing tourism landscape.
